Tender Opportunity: Panel of Contractors for the Maintenance of Water Treatment Works, Wastewater Works and Pump Stations (As and When Required)
- Tender Number: 3/2/001/2026-27
- Department: Moqhaka Local Municipality
- Tender Type: Open Request for Bid (Open Tender)
- Location: Kroonstad, Free State
- Contract Duration: 3 Years (Panel Appointment)
- CIDB Requirement: Grade 6 ME (Mechanical Engineering Works)
- Closing Date: 7 September 2026 at 12:00
Tender Objective
Moqhaka Local Municipality intends to appoint a panel of up to five contractors to provide maintenance services for water treatment works, wastewater treatment works, and pump stations on an as-and-when-required basis over a three-year period. The aim is to ensure the reliable operation and maintenance of critical municipal water and sanitation infrastructure.
Scope of Work
The appointed contractors will be responsible for:
- Maintenance of water treatment works.
- Maintenance of wastewater treatment works.
- Maintenance of pump stations.
- Mechanical and electrical repairs.
- Supply and installation of replacement parts and equipment.
- Preventive maintenance.
- Fault finding and diagnostics.
- Equipment inspections.
- Emergency maintenance when required.
- Compliance with technical specifications, safety standards, and quality management requirements.
Technical Requirements
The contractor must be capable of providing:
Mechanical Services
- Maintenance and repair of water and sewer pumps.
- Mechanical fault diagnosis.
- Pump overhauls.
- Supply and installation of mechanical spares.
Electrical Services
- Electrical fault finding and repairs.
- Rewinding and overhauling electric motors of various sizes.
- Installation of electrical equipment.
- Supply of electrical replacement parts.
Equipment Requirements
Contractors should own or have access to equipment such as:
- Crane trucks
- Maintenance vehicles
- Mechanical repair tools
- Electrical testing equipment
Personnel Requirements
The successful bidder must provide qualified personnel, including:
Contract Manager
- Degree in Electrical or Mechanical Engineering.
- Registered with ECSA as a Professional Engineer (Pr. Eng.) or Professional Engineering Technologist (Pr. Tech.).
Fitter and Turner
- Valid Trade Test Certificate.
- Relevant maintenance experience.
Electrician
- Valid Trade Test Certificate.
- Experience in industrial electrical maintenance.
Quality and Compliance Requirements
Contractors must demonstrate:
- An ISO 9001-certified Quality Management System.
- Compliance with occupational health and safety legislation.
- Compliance with environmental regulations.
- Performance monitoring in accordance with Service Level Agreements (SLAs).
Experience Requirements
Bidders should demonstrate:
- Proven experience maintaining water and wastewater infrastructure.
- Experience with similar municipal or industrial projects.
- Mechanical and electrical maintenance expertise.
- Ability to provide technical supervision and project management.
- Sufficient resources and equipment to execute maintenance work.
Panel Appointment
- A maximum of five contractors will be appointed.
- Work will be allocated through a rotational quotation process among panel members.
- The municipality may source quotations outside the panel where necessary, in accordance with its procurement policies.
